Output 52092064c446fc95c11955cc6850684d3294fad0d2aa4d1066df67d58c23ab24:2

value
24996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afd76e0c5fde913173783896a52411668c27130 OP_EQUAL
address
3LCL4JjFFT32Vx1q7HkmkkWs6Xe5i1J61d
transaction
52092064c446fc95c11955cc6850684d3294fad0d2aa4d1066df67d58c23ab24
spent
true